Output e59fc9a109da21585e7274198fac8186d12fe25f6ff281b7b07cc4fbbcf5e8de:1

value
18817519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 922900182d3bfdb553fcb7295c352a3b46c54439 OP_EQUAL
address
MMDz1C9WrcWVed8V1uNV2Xtsdjcxp7kTxR
transaction
e59fc9a109da21585e7274198fac8186d12fe25f6ff281b7b07cc4fbbcf5e8de
spent
true